一.准备:准备像素大小相同的图片若干张。(本例中的图片,统一像素大小为310*310,请保存至本机电脑并按顺序命名为1.jpg至6.jpg)二.启动与登陆: 启动谷歌浏览器,并在地址栏里输入localhost:8888,登陆离线账号 三.组件设计1.相册组件界面:image图像 、button 按钮参考:为了在设计代码时,能更明确地针对各个组件。特对组件进行重命名。 &nb
# Android Bitmap翻转 ## 简介 在Android开发中,经常需要对图片进行各种各样的操作,其中之一就是对Bitmap进行翻转Bitmap翻转是指将图片沿着水平或垂直方向进行镜像翻转,从而改变图片的显示效果。本文将介绍Android中如何进行Bitmap翻转,并提供相应的代码示例。 ## Bitmap翻转方法 Android提供了Matrix类来进行图像变换操作,通过Mat
原创 2023-12-21 09:00:37
270阅读
场景:WPF下用Image控件展示图片;控件的图片源自然选用BitmapImage; BitmapImage通过Uri对象指向磁盘的某个文件。   显示正常,但是这时候如果我们再有别的地方要操作这个磁盘文件,比如程序中或者其他地方,就会说资源已被占用,这个网友大师们已经发现了这个问题,并提出了解决方案。见:http://www.silverlightchin
基于android-6.0.1_r80源代码分析通过下面三个章节基本可以扫清Bitmap盲区。文章没有覆盖到的一方面是Bitmap用法,这部分建议阅读Glide库源代码。一些Color的概念,例如premultiplied / Dither,需要具备一定CG物理基础,不管怎样先读下去。Bitmap对象创建Bitmap java层构造函数是通过native层jni call过来的,逻辑在Bitmap
# 如何在Android翻转Bitmap ## 整体流程 首先我们需要明确整个流程,下面是实现Android翻转Bitmap的步骤: | 步骤 | 操作 | | ---- | ---- | | 1 | 加载需要翻转Bitmap | | 2 | 创建一个Matrix对象 | | 3 | 在Matrix对象中设置翻转操作 | | 4 | 使用Matrix对象对Bitmap进行翻转操作 |
原创 2024-06-07 05:43:16
125阅读
我们这里主要是通过对android.graphics.Camera的操作来实现3D的变化,Camera的坐标系为三维左手坐标系,因此我们可以通过操作它来实现一些3D的效果。接下来我对各段代码进行详细说明。下面这段代码是为了防止当图像旋转到90度的时候,图像的侧面刚好朝着我们导致看起来过大的问题,因此我们需要将图像沿着Z轴移动一下,就相当于一辆车从你身后往前开你会感觉车越来越小一个道理。//让旋转9
转载 10月前
158阅读
# Android Bitmap 翻转角度的科普介绍 在Android开发中,处理图像是一项非常重要的任务。BitmapAndroid中用于处理和显示图形的主要类之一,在项目开发中经常会遇到需要旋转Bitmap的情况。本文将介绍如何翻转Bitmap的角度,并提供代码示例进行说明。 ## 什么是BitmapBitmap是一种用于描述点阵图像的计算机位图格式。在Android中,Bitma
原创 7月前
41阅读
# Android Bitmap 3D 翻转Android 开发中,经常需要对图片进行各种处理,其中一个常见的需求是对图片进行翻转。本文将介绍如何使用 AndroidBitmap 类实现一个简单的 3D 翻转效果,并提供相应的代码示例。 ## 准备工作 在开始之前,我们需要准备一张用于翻转的图片资源。在 res 目录下的 drawable 文件夹中添加一张图片(命名为 "imag
原创 2024-01-28 04:55:56
67阅读
# Android Bitmap镜像实现 作为一名经验丰富的开发者,我将教会你如何实现在Android中创建镜像效果的Bitmap。首先,让我们来看看整个实现过程的流程: ```mermaid graph TD A[开始] --> B[获取原始Bitmap] B --> C[创建一个空白的Bitmap,宽度和高度与原始Bitmap相同] C --> D[创建一个Canvas对象,并以新创建的B
原创 2023-08-28 06:36:42
401阅读
Android Bitmap镜像实现 在Android开发中,有时我们需要对Bitmap进行镜像操作。本文将教你如何实现Android中的Bitmap镜像功能。 1. 准备工作 在开始实现之前,我们需要先明确一下整个过程的流程。下面是实现Android Bitmap镜像的步骤: | 步骤 | 描述 | | --- | --- | | 步骤一 | 加载原始图片 | | 步骤二 | 创建一个空的
原创 2023-12-20 08:00:47
110阅读
最近有个需求需要实现图片的水平、垂直翻转功能,开发完之后感觉挺有意思的,就来总结一下css实现图片翻转功能利用css动画属性rotate旋转来实现:水平翻转:transform: rotateY(180deg); /* 水平镜像翻转 */垂直翻转:transform: rotateX(180deg); /* 垂直镜像翻转 */这里rotateY(180deg) 表示元素以Y轴镜像翻转,即水平翻转
# Android View 镜像翻转详解 在Android开发中,镜像翻转是一种常见效果,尤其是在处理图像、视频或者用户界面时。通过镜像翻转,可以显示出“镜子”视图的效果,常用于游戏、图像编辑器或者增强现实应用中。本文将详细介绍如何在Android中实现视图的镜像翻转,并提供代码示例及相关理论知识。 ## 为什么需要镜像翻转镜像翻转的应用场景非常广泛,例如: - 图像处理:用户常常需
原创 2024-08-22 09:02:10
725阅读
# Android 照片镜像翻转实现指南 在这个教程中,我们将教你如何在 Android 应用中实现照片镜像翻转的功能。整个过程相对简单,尤其是对于初学者来说,通过逐步的引导,你会掌握这个功能的实现方式。 ## 实现流程 下面是实现照片镜像翻转的主要步骤: | 步骤 | 描述 | |------|-------------------
原创 7月前
51阅读
# 实现 Android 视频镜像翻转的完整指南 在现代移动应用开发中,视频处理的重要性越来越突出。尤其是对于需要显示图像的应用,如视频聊天和直播应用,镜像翻转功能尤为关键。本指南将通过详细步骤教会你如何在 Android 应用程序中实现视频镜像翻转。以下是实现的流程和对应代码的详细说明。 ## 实现流程 首先,让我们概述实现镜像翻转的整体流程,下面是实现过程的步骤: ```mermaid
原创 7月前
74阅读
# Android中实现Bitmap镜像效果的方法 ## 摘要 本文将详细介绍如何在Android应用中实现对Bitmap进行镜像处理的方法,适合刚入行的开发者学习和参考。 ## 步骤概览 下表展示了整个实现“android bitmap镜像”过程的步骤: | 步骤 | 描述 | | --- | --- | | 1 | 加载原始Bitmap | | 2 | 创建一个Matrix对象 | |
原创 2024-06-08 05:53:01
96阅读
## Android Bitmap图像镜像处理 在Android应用开发中,Bitmap是一种用于处理图像的主要数据结构。Bitmap可以代表一个位图图像,它由许多不同大小的像素组成。在图像处理过程中,镜像是一种常见的操作,通常用来实现图像的左右反转或上下翻转。本文将介绍如何在Android中实现Bitmap图像的镜像处理,提供相关代码示例,并使用甘特图和表格来展示项目进度和参数。 ### 一
# Android Bitmap 左右镜像处理 在Android开发中,处理图像是一项常见的任务。许多应用程序需要通过对原始图像进行修改来创建新的视觉效果。其中,左右镜像(又称水平翻转)是一种简单而有效的图像处理方式。本文将介绍如何使用Android中的Bitmap进行左右镜像处理,并提供相应的代码示例。 ## 什么是 Bitmap ? `Bitmap`是Android中用于表示位图图像的类
原创 10月前
206阅读
记录元素平移、旋转、缩放和镜像翻转(4)接下来就是一些收尾的工作,实现镜像翻转功能。这个功能就相对来说比较简单了,这里只做简单的实现,使用 css 即可。首先为元素新增字段来确定翻转效果,这个效果就两种,翻转和不翻转,所以使用 boolean 值。/** * 处理元素属性 * * @param {Object} options 元素属性 */ handleOptions(options =
转载 2024-07-26 01:33:57
280阅读
目标效果如何实现上图的效果?大家是不是首先想到:用个 3D 相机,设置 3D 节点去旋转 rotationY,然后再移动这个节点?我的第一反应也是如此。但是这样一来就得新增一个 3D 相机,并且需要增加一个分组,使这张图只被 3D 相机渲染不被 2D 相机渲染,同时还要额外管理这个 3D 相机。那么,能不能用 2D 相机来实现这个效果呢?答案是当然是:能!尝试一:模拟 3D 旋转运动既然要模拟 3
转载 2024-06-03 08:04:15
179阅读
直播伴侣内置安卓/苹果手机投屏,无需第三方投屏软件,斗鱼直播伴侣轻松搞定。 一、安卓手机投屏准备工作:1、 在安卓手机上安装斗鱼APP(4.4.0及以上版本,点此下载);2、 在电脑上安装斗鱼直播伴侣(2.1.12及以上版本,点此下载);3、 确保电脑与手机在同一个Wi-Fi(局域网)。步骤:1、 启动斗鱼直播伴侣,打开手游-苹果投屏界面:2、
  • 1
  • 2
  • 3
  • 4
  • 5